This is a very nice park. To visit San Francisco, it is really convenient to take the train from Petaluma to the ferry terminal, then to San Fran. For us, we were disappointed in our site. When we got there, the grass at our site was a foot tall. We went up to the office and asked if someone could come down and mow. They said yes. We were there a week and it did not get mowed.

Nicer KOA as far as the grounds and layout. Since you cannot specify a site at booking on line the registration desk should ask Where do you want to be in the park? Away from the noisy activities area or close to the pool? Easy to do, none of the KOA's do it. We booked a standard site and ended up right at the activity pavilion with tons of kids, tractors, movies, breakfast etc. around us.

The campground is nice but be aware that if you need to do laundry there, you are forced to sign up for an app on your phone in order to use their machines that do not accept credit cards or coins. My husband and I have traveled all over the country and this is the first time we have encountered this. We didn't want to have to acquired an unwanted app on our phones and the instructions for acquiring it aren't easy. So we had to haul our laundry to a local laundromat and as we were leaving we saw other guests taking their laundry back after they left too. I complained nicely to a staff member who didn't seem to care. Having said that the campground is nice, surrounded by pine trees and redwoods. It's real advantage is being near the ferry boats going over to San Francisco. Be aware, while there is a local train going to the ferry, where it lets you off is three quarters to a mile walk to the ferry. In rain it would be very unpleasant and no one tells you how far the walk is. It is better to drive your car to the ferry and pay the $2 on the digital parking meter. We took the train once and drove three other times. Other than that, the campground is in a nice setting and near wine country too.
